While shiplap uses rabbeted edges to connect the boards, tongue and groove planks interlock at the edges. The interlocking edges keep out the elements better than rabbeted edges. NettetThere are methods of removing sections of the tongue and groove - clamping to squeeze them together and patching the sections that are removed similar to wood flooring repairs. This takes a bit of time and trial and error. It would be less expensive to remove and reinstall once the tongue and groove has stabilized.
